Output 260aa36b59e0ea082f3ccfa20569bf53d2fda85745041d1a26ce50eb17083e56:1

value
1707808
script pubkey
OP_0 OP_PUSHBYTES_20 8d66399c1d48416c7f711ff6844a17d51a5017e5
address
ltc1q34nrn8qafpqkclm3rlmggjsh65d9q9l9lpkmfs
transaction
260aa36b59e0ea082f3ccfa20569bf53d2fda85745041d1a26ce50eb17083e56
spent
true